Lewis Hamilton returns to Ferrari action as Imola emerges as 2026 finale option

Summary by Planet F1
Lewis Hamilton wasted little time getting back behind the wheel as Ferrari's Imola test takes on added significance.

12 Articles

Pirelli conducted a two-day tire development test at the Imola Circuit for the 2027 F1 season, with Ferrari and Racing Bulls participating. Lewis Hamilton and Charles Leclerc took part on the first day, while Antonio Giovinazzi, Liam Lawson, and Arvid Lindblad participated on the second day. A total of 400 laps and 1963km of data were collected over the two days.

The Cavallino is back in action on the Santerno circuit, this time without Hamilton and Leclerc. The test for Pirelli 2027 tyres with the SF-26 was carried out by Giovinazzi, while Beganovic led the SF-25 for a Tpc test. Tests with the new Pirelli compounds also for Racing Bulls with Lindblad and Lawson.
